Destination Point Code
Transfer Assignment
General Description
Use this Memory Block to assign the Destination Point Code to the associated Common
Signalling Channel when K-CCIS commands are required to pass through a tandem
system. This Memory Block is used for Centralised K-CCIS features
.
With System Software R2000 or higher, a CCH Channel i can be assigned for K-CCIS over IP.

Programming Procedures
1
Go off-line.
2
Press LK1 + LK15 + KE to access the Memory Block.
3 Use dial pad keys to enter Setting Data.
Note: Use the following to enter data:
Jto move cursor left.
Lto move cursor right.
K~Ito enter numeric data.
Note: Point Code Range is 00001~16367
T001~T255 can be assigned.
Default Values
:
Blank
4
PressNto write the data.
5
PressPto go back on-line.
